What is a BRC, CCH, and Request for Review?

• Benefit Review Conference (BRC) A BRC is an informal mediation meant to try to resolve disputes between injured workers and insurance companies. It is an adversarial process where by the insurance company normally hires an attorney to represent them in an effort to win, and therefore all injured workers should consider hiring an attorney as well. • Contested Case Hearing (CCH) A CCH is a more formal process and is considered an Administrative Trial. Any disputes between insurance companies and injured workers are sent to a CCH for adjudication. A judge, called a Hearing Officer hears evidence and testimony from the insurance company and the injured worker and issues a written decision, which is then binding on the parties. Insurance companies almost always have attorneys at this stage and it is highly recommended that you do as well. • Request for Review A Request for Review is a written appeal of a decision from a CCH that is sent to the Appeals Panel.
